People of 50 Ctg villages to observe Ramadan from Thursday

Wednesday, 17 June 2015


Muslims in some villages of a south-eastern district of Bangladesh will observe Ramadan from Thursday, although the new crescent moon of the Holy month of fasting and restraint is not yet spotted from any places of Bangladesh till Wednesday late afternoon. A news agency reported on Wednesday that people of 50 villages of southern area of Chittagong district will observe Holy Ramadan from Thursday, keeping similarity with Saudi Arabia which announced that Ramadan will commence there on Thursday. The devotees of the 50 villages of Chittagong will be fasting durig daytime on Thursday after having Sehri before Fazr prayers. They will say Tarabi prayers tonight (Wednesday), representatives of people and local administration officials of two upazilas – Satkania and Chandanaish upazilas where the 50 villages are situated – said on Wednesday, according to a news agency.
